Quantitative microbiology of human vulva
The British Journal of Dermatology
|October 1, 1979
Summary
The vulva harbors significantly higher microbial counts than the forearm. Key bacteria like diphtheroids and staphylococci dominate the vulvar flora, with Staphylococcus aureus being most prevalent on the vulva.

Background:
- The skin's microbial flora varies significantly across different body sites.
- Understanding the vulvar microbiome is crucial for assessing skin health and potential infections.
Purpose of the Study:
- To characterize the microbial flora of the vulva.
- To compare the vulvar microflora with that of the forearm.
Main Methods:
- Utilized the detergent scrub method for microbial sampling.
- Quantified microbial counts per square centimeter.
- Identified dominant bacterial and fungal species.
Main Results:
- Microbial counts were substantially higher on the vulva (2.8 x 10^6/cm²) compared to the forearm (6.4 x 10^2/cm²).
- Dominant vulvar flora included lipophilic diphtheroids, coagulase-negative staphylococci, micrococci, non-lipophilic diphtheroids, and lactobacilli.
- Staphylococcus aureus showed the highest incidence on the vulva (67%).
Conclusions:
- The vulva presents a distinct and more abundant microbial profile than the forearm.
- Specific bacterial groups are characteristic of the vulvar microflora.
- The high prevalence of S. aureus on the vulva warrants further investigation.
